Principal Translations
InglésEspañol
lure [sb/sth] vtr (entice, tempt)atraer vtr
  tentar vtr
Note: Ante complemento directo de persona debe usarse la preposición «a».
 The smell of cooking meat lured the wild animals.
 El olor de la comida atrajo a los animales salvajes.
lure [sb/sth] into [sth] vtr + prep (entice into)atraer a alguien hacia algo loc verb
 The police lured the criminal into a trap.
 La policía atrajo al criminal hacia una trampa.
lure [sb/sth] into doing [sth] v expr (entice into doing)hacer que alguien haga algo loc verb
  inducir a alguien a hacer algo loc verb
 The interviewer tried to lure the politician into admitting that he had made a mistake.
 La entrevistadora trató de hacer que el político admitiera que había cometido un error.
lure n (fishing)cebo nm
  señuelo nm
  carnada nf
 Tom tried a new lure on his fishing trip.
 Tom probó un cebo nuevo en su excursión de pesca.
lure n ([sth] tempting) (figurado)cebo nm
  encanto nm
  atractivo nm
  tentación nf
 The siren's song acts as a lure to passing sailors.
 El canto de la sirena actúa como cebo para los marineros que pasan por allí.
lure n (tempting quality)encanto nm
  atractivo nm
 The lure of faraway lands grew too great for Elsa; she couldn't stay at home any longer.
 El encanto de las tierras lejanas era demasiado para Elsa: no podía quedarse en su pueblo ni un minuto más.
